    Dinah Manoff (born January 25, 1956) is an American stage, film, and television actress and television director. She is best known for her roles as Carol Weston on Empty Nest , Elaine Lefkowitz on Soap , Marty Maraschino in the film Grease , and Libby Tucker in both the stage and film adaptations of I Ought to Be in Pictures , for which she won ...

    Dinah Manoff. Actress: Grease. Dinah Manoff was born in New York City, New York, to screenwriter Arnold Manoff and actress, director, and writer Lee Grant. She began her professional career in the PBS production of "The Great Cherub Knitwear Strike".

  4. In television, Manoff is best known for her portrayal as Richard Mulligan's daughter "Carol Weston," the character she played for seven years on Empty Nest. She went on to star in the highly acclaimed ABC family series State of Grace, for which she received a Jewish Image Award.
